1. 将/prebuild/gcc/linux-x86/arm/arm-linux-androideabi-4.6/bin/arm-linux-androideabi-gdb 拷贝到/usr/local/bin下
2. 进入out/target/product/工程名xxx/obj/KERNEL_OBJ 目录,找到文件vmlinux
3. 执行arm-linux-androideabi-gdb vmlinux,进入gdb调试界面
4. 输入 list * 函数名+行号,会显示出错对应的文件和行号
本文介绍了一种在安卓平台上使用GDB进行内核调试的方法。主要包括:将arm-linux-androideabi-gdb复制到系统路径;定位vmlinux文件;启动gdb并连接vmlinux;利用特定命令获取出错位置。
1449

被折叠的 条评论
为什么被折叠?



